Abstract
The utility model relates to a kind of automatic tapping device continuously; comprise the index unit of tooth machining unit, horizontally disposed rotating disk and driving dial rotation; on described rotating disk, circular array is furnished with plural localization tool; the rotate path of described localization tool is through the processing stations of tooth machining unit; the output revolving shaft of described index unit connects center of turntable, and the both sides of described tooth machining unit processing stations are provided with protection grating.The utility model arranges plural localization tool on rotating disk; rotating disk is driven by index unit; make each localization tool can arrive the processing stations of tooth machining unit in the time period of separating; operating personnel are able to the continued operation realizing placing product and tapping in each localization tool; greatly improve the efficiency of work; in addition, if operationally tooth machining unit peripheral extent has personnel to enter by mistake, the protection grating of tooth machining unit processing stations both sides can carry out detecting, report to the police and shutting down.The utility model can be applicable to tapping operation.
Description
Technical field
The utility model relates to a kind of tapping device, particularly a kind of automatic tapping device continuously.
Background technology
Tapping technology is a kind of machining process making combination between component and component firm by plant equipment and take, and needs to carry out tapping operation to it in vehicle dormer window inserts.At present, the tapping mode of single tool is generally adopted in factory.Specifically skylight inserts is put into a set of tool, tooth machining unit tapping afterwards, then take out product, next product is put into this cover tool, so circulation repeatedly.But this its labour intensity of manually operated mode is large, the utilization rate of machine is low, causes whole course of work inefficiency.

Detailed description of the invention
Continuous automatic tapping device as depicted in figs. 1 and 2, the index unit 3 comprising tooth machining unit 1, horizontally disposed rotating disk 2 and drive rotating disk 2 to rotate.Tooth machining unit 1 has the stroke of lifting, and its tapping screw tap is positioned at the top of rotating disk 2.
On rotating disk 2, annular arranged in arrays has plural localization tool 4, and the output revolving shaft of index unit 3 connects rotating disk 2 center, and when rotating disk 2 rotates, the rotate path of localization tool 4 is through the processing stations of tooth machining unit 1.Index unit 3 can make rotating disk 2 stop after rotating a certain angle, and again rotates after separated in time.Because localization tool 4 circular array is arranged, the rotation of so each rotating disk 2 can make localization tool 4 just be positioned on processing stations, is also immediately below tooth machining unit 1 tapping screw tap.Thus, operating personnel can tapping on the localization tool being placed with product, and can put into product in idle localization tool simultaneously, thus increases work efficiency.
The both sides of tooth machining unit 1 processing stations are also provided with protection grating 5.As shown in Figure 1; two protection gratings 5 are in the front of tooth machining unit 1; if there is personnel's maloperation staff to be crossed the detection range of protection grating 5 in tapping process; so protect grating 5 namely can give the alarm; and quit work by corresponding controller control tooth machining unit 1, bring safe working environment to user.
Preferably, rotating disk 2 is provided with two identical localization tool 4, two localization tools 4 and is centrosymmetric distribution with the center of rotation of rotating disk 2.Identical localization tool can carry out continued operation to a product, also i.e. tapping on a localization tool wherein, another puts into product, rotating disk 2 revolves turnback afterwards, take out the complete product of tapping and put in the localization tool of correspondence and treat tapping product, and tapping is started to the product turned on the localization tool of processing stations simultaneously.
Preferably, localization tool 4 is provided with the imitation-shaped groove treating tapping product, and product is put into imitation-shaped groove and can accurately be located.
In the present embodiment, as shown in Figure 2, index unit 3 comprises Cam splitter 31 and motor reducer 32.The output shaft of Cam splitter 31 connects rotating disk 2 center, by motor reducer 32 driving cam dispenser 31.
Preferably, the output shaft of motor reducer 32 is connected to driving pulley 33, and the power shaft of Cam splitter 31 is connected to driven pulley 34, and driving pulley 33 is connected by driving-belt 35 with driven pulley 34.
